I'm a fifth-generation Floridian, and our family's roots in Palm Beach County run deep. We started in farming — and over five generations have stayed close to the land in different ways. Today, the family business sells the tractors that keep this part of the country growing. Most people don't realize it, but the western half of Palm Beach County is one of the largest agricultural producers in America: sugarcane, sweet corn, bell peppers, leafy greens, miles of fields just inland from the shore.
The palm in our logo grows from a sugarcane trunk on purpose. A small nod to the land we're from — where ag meets the beach, and where five generations of my family have called home.
